Man arrested in connection to fatal April shooting in Jacksonville

Police say Brandon Engeloff, 32, is facing second-degree murder, accessory after the fact and possession of a firearm by a convicted felon.

J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— A man has been arrested in connection to a fatal shooting that took place nearly four months ago on Jacksonville’s Westside.

The Jacksonville Sheriff’s Office (JSO) has announced that 32-year-old Brandon Engeloff is charged with second-degree murder, being an accessory after the fact, and possessing a firearm as a convicted felon.

At around 6:30 a.m. April 15, officers had responded to a call about a shooting on the 2900 block of Ernest Street.

Upon arrival, JSO reports that officers discovered the victim, 33-year-old Christopher Cam, with gunshot injuries. Jacksonville Fire and Rescue Department first responders quickly arrived at the scene and transported Cam to a nearby hospital, where he succumbed to his injuries.

The sheriff’s office stated that the medical examiner later classified the cause of death as a homicide. During their investigation, detectives communicated with witnesses and sought out surveillance footage from the surrounding area.

JSO said the the investigation led detectives to identify Engeloff as a suspect. He was booked in Duval County Jail.
